When your bulkhead leaks, you need to correct the problem quickly because the last thing you need in the already humid environment of a basement is more water Leaks can happen through the doors or through the bulkhead foundation, which is usually added onto the building foundation and sealed by a rubber cold joint. A leaky bulkhead can cause serious water intrusion problems in your basement, especially in homes with precast concrete bulkheads These entry points, while functional, are notorious for letting moisture creep in through cracks, unsealed seams, or aging gaskets.

Most often when we're seeing water coming through here, it's because there's a rocking motion with these bulkheads
